HeyTaco helps build stronger company culture by inspiring positive communication and bringing people together through social recognition. Each person has five tacos to give to other team members every day. Tacos are given to show gratitude and recognize everything from small wins to huge accomplishments. People can then use their accrued tacos to redeem exciting rewards.
With gamification mechanisms like leaderboards and achievement levels, HeyTaco makes peer-to-peer recognition fun and rewarding. In addition, by using tacos as a currency, the silliness and less seriousness lead to higher engagement and more genuine recognition.

Sooo. Unity. It's a 3D game engine created by a company of the same name. It was published in 2005 and is one of the most used game engines in the world due to its simplicity, the number of documents, and the easy way to publish games on all platforms. - Source: dev.to / 5 months ago
Unity is a popular game engine and development platform that is widely used for creating games, as well as aug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) applications. It provides a comprehensive set of tools, libraries, and features that enable developers to build interactive and immersive experiences across various platforms. - Source: dev.to / 6 months ago
